Bear MCP Tools for Cline (10)
These 10 tools become available when you connect Bear to Cline via MCP:
add_text
Append or prepend Markdown chunks to a Bear note
archive_note
Archive an explicit Bear Note
create_note
Create a new native Bear note
delete_tag
Destroy entirely a Tag constraint globally

open_note
Retrieve explicit complete Markdown content of a Bear note
open_tag
List all explicit Bear notes matching a specific tag
rename_tag
Rename globally an entire tag across all mapped Notes
search_notes

trash_note
Move an explicit Bear Note to the Trash
